   Sorry, I know it's a very vague question! I'll try and get some more metrics.
   
   The pagespeed is on a disk, with a redis cache also. 
   The proxy type is Azure Front Door which is Microsoft's CDN network. I have unique query URLs cached -- it should also respect cache headers from source. Maybe the two aren't interacting well together.
   
   Switching pagespeed off and on using the URL parameters causes a difference:
   ![image](https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/446329/79118597-b534e180-7dd1-11ea-8314-388d3ba41612.png)
   
   The timings when debug is enabled are as follows:
   
   ```<!--
   mod_pagespeed on
   Filters:
   db	Debug
   hw	Flushes html
   
   Options:
   AvoidRenamingIntrospectiveJavascript (aris) True
   EnableCachePurge (euci) True
   EnableRewriting (e) 1
   FileCacheCleanIntervalMs (afcci) 86400000
   FileCacheInodeLimit (afcl) 500000
   FileCacheSizeKb (afc) 2048000
   RewriteLevel (l) Pass Through
   Statistics (ase) True
   StatisticsLogging (asle) True
   
   #NumFlushes            0
   #EndDocument after     216021us
   #Total Parse duration  2208us
   #Total Render duration 695us
   #Total Idle duration   213813us
   The following filters were disabled for this request:
   	SupportNoscript
   -->```
   
   The config is currently as follows
   
   
   ```
   
   # pagespeed
   pagespeed standby;
   
   pagespeed FileCachePath "/var/cache/pagespeed/";
   pagespeed FileCacheSizeKb            2048000;
   pagespeed FileCacheCleanIntervalMs   86400000;
   pagespeed FileCacheInodeLimit        500000;
   
   pagespeed RedisServer "localhost:6379";
   
   pagespeed RewriteLevel PassThrough;
   pagespeed DisableFilters "rewrite_images,resize_images";
   
   pagespeed Statistics on;
   pagespeed StatisticsLogging on;
   pagespeed LogDir /var/log/pagespeed;
   pagespeed AdminPath /pagespeed_admin;
   
   pagespeed EnableCachePurge on;
   pagespeed PurgeMethod PURGE;
   
   ```
   
   So if I interpret those stats correctly, the long Idle duration suggests the FTTB is mostly caused by the underlying page?
